Nigeria’s President on Tuesday met with Niger Delta representatives as part of efforts toward finding lasting solutions to the crisis in the region.

buhari-meeting-with-niger-delta-elders4

The News Agency of Nigeria (NAN) reports that those attending the meeting are Vice-President Yemi Osinbajo, some governors, ministers and other political appointees from the Niger Delta region.

Names of those that attended the meeting include:

Governors of Akwa Ibom – Emmanuel Udom

Governor of Bayelsa state – Seriake Dickson

Governor of Delta – Ifeanyi Okowa

Imo State Governor – Rochas Okorocha and Deputy

Others are:

Service Chiefs, Inspector-General of Police Idris Ibrahim

Director-General of the Department of State Services (DSS), Lawal Daura

Some traditional rulers and representatives of militant groups.

Some former governors, civil rights activists and community leaders from the Niger Delta region. They include

Victor Attah

Edwin Clark

Timi Alaibe

Diette Spiff

Ledum Mitee

Florence Ita-Giwa

Tony Uranta

Nkoyo Toyo

Ewa Henshaw

Seminatri Bozimo and

Roland Owei.

The ministers attending the meeting are those of Interior, Justice, Transport, Budget and National Planning as well as Ministers of State for Health, Niger Delta Affairs.

The Chairmen, Senate and House of Representatives committees on Upstream, Downstream as well as Niger Delta are also in the meeting.
